WebJan 20, 2024 · Excess Light Exposure. Another common cause of brown spots on bird of paradise is too much sunlight or heat. The plant enjoys plenty of light. And it thrives when given 6 or more hours of sunlight daily. However, keep in mind that the plant cannot tolerate very intense light including direct sunlight. When white fuzzy spots appear on any plant, powdery mildew is frequently the first culprit that pops to mind. Indeed, this fungal infection is the most common cause of white spots on a bird of paradise. Break out your investigative glasses. Typically, they feed on the underside of leaves and lay eggs under the leaves. Even a large plant, such as Bird of Paradise, can become sick with a large infestation of these mites since colonies can rapidly grow.
